Анастасия0000000000
07.10.2022 07:01

СОР по информатике 6 класс​


СОР по информатике 6 класс​

Нажмите на рекламу ниже и сразу увидите ответ
Популярные вопросы:
Ответ:
Zhanna278
13.05.2021 22:35

Решение Pascal

Delphi/Pascal

program Case5;

var

 N,A,B:Integer;

begin

 Write('Введите номер действия: ');

 Readln(N);

 Write('Введите число A: ');

 Readln(A);

 Write('Введите число B: ');

 Readln(B);

 

 Case N of

   1: Writeln(A+B);

   2: Writeln(A-B);

   3: Writeln(A*B);

   4: Writeln(A/B);

 end;

end.

1

2

3

4

5

6

7

8

9

10

11

12

13

14

15

16

17

18

program Case5;

var

 N,A,B:Integer;

begin

 Write('Введите номер действия: ');

 Readln(N);

 Write('Введите число A: ');

 Readln(A);

 Write('Введите число B: ');

 Readln(B);

 

 Case N of

   1: Writeln(A+B);

   2: Writeln(A-B);

   3: Writeln(A*B);

   4: Writeln(A/B);

 end;

end.

 

Решение C

C

#include <stdio.h>

 

int main(void)

{

  system("chcp 1251");

  int n;

  float a,b;

  printf("N:") ;

  scanf ("%i", &n);

  printf("A:") ;

  scanf ("%f", &a);

  printf("B:") ;

  scanf ("%f", &b);

 

  switch (n) {

  case 1:

      printf("%f\n",a+b) ;

      break;

  case 2:

      printf("%f\n",a-b) ;

      break;

  case 3:

      printf("%f\n",a*b) ;

      break;

  case 4:

      printf("%f\n",a/b) ;

      break;

  }

  return 0;

}

1

2

3

4

5

6

7

8

9

10

11

12

13

14

15

16

17

18

19

20

21

22

23

24

25

26

27

28

29

30

#include <stdio.h>

 

int main(void)

{

  system("chcp 1251");

  int n;

  float a,b;

  printf("N:") ;

  scanf ("%i", &n);

  printf("A:") ;

  scanf ("%f", &a);

  printf("B:") ;

  scanf ("%f", &b);

 

  switch (n) {

  case 1:

      printf("%f\n",a+b) ;

      break;

  case 2:

      printf("%f\n",a-b) ;

      break;

  case 3:

      printf("%f\n",a*b) ;

      break;

  case 4:

      printf("%f\n",a/b) ;

      break;

  }

  return 0;

}

Объяснение:

0,0(0 оценок)
Ответ:
Head5
04.01.2020 04:48
В основе лежит формула определения расстояния между двумя точками в прямоугольной системе координат, при этом одна из точек совпадает с началом системы координат. В этом случае искомое расстояние определяется по формуле:
L= \sqrt{a_x^2+a_y^2}
Поскольку в задаче не ставится вопрос определения самого расстояния, достаточно для каждой точки вычислить значение L² и сравнить их.
Окончательно задача сводится к нахождению минимального из значений
a_x^2+a_y^2 по заданным координатам х и у.

var
  ax, ay, bx, by, rx, ry: real;

begin
  writeln('Введите координаты первой точки');
  readln(ax, ay);
  writeln('Введите координаты второй точки');
  readln(bx, by);
  rx := sqr(ax) + sqr(ay);
  ry := sqr(bx) + sqr(by);
  if rx < ry then writeln('Первая точка ближе')
  else
  if rx > ry then writeln('Вторая точка ближе')
  else writeln('Обе точки равноудалены')
end. 
0,0(0 оценок)
Полный доступ
Позволит учиться лучше и быстрее. Неограниченный доступ к базе и ответам от экспертов и ai-bota Оформи подписку
logo
Начни делиться знаниями
Вход Регистрация
Что ты хочешь узнать?
Спроси ai-бота